What Is a Christian Marriage Biodata?

A Christian marriage biodata (or matrimonial profile) is a detailed document used by families and individuals to find a suitable life partner. Alongside standard personal and professional details, it places a special emphasis on a person's faith, including their specific Denomination (Catholic, Protestant, Orthodox, etc.) and active Church details, ensuring that both families share compatible religious and social values.

What to Include in a Christian Marriage Biodata

A transparent, well-detailed profile acts as the perfect introduction to your future partner's family.

Contact Details

Always ensure you provide up-to-date contact information. This typically includes a primary contact number (often a parent or elder), an alternative contact number, a reachable email address, and your complete residential address.

Personal and Family Details

Personal Details

Include your full name, Date of Birth, exact Height, and Marital Status. Providing an honest self-description regarding your personality, hobbies, and life goals helps potential matches understand you better.

Family Background

Christian matchmaking heavily involves families. Detail your Father's and Mother's names and their occupations. Mention your siblings, their educational background, and whether they are married or unmarried.

Church and Denomination Details

Faith is a foundational pillar in Christian marriages. Clearly communicating your church ties is vital.

Denomination

Are you Roman Catholic, CSI, CNI, Mar Thoma, Pentecostal, Baptist, or from an Independent/Non-denominational background? Mentioning your exact denomination early prevents theological incompatibilities down the line.

Church Details

Include the specific name and location of the church you and your family regularly attend. Some families may also prefer to mention if they are actively involved in church ministries (like the choir, youth group, or Sunday school).

Education and Professional Details

Education

Start with your most recent and highest educational degree (e.g., MS, B.Tech, Nursing, MBA), and include the name of the college/university and graduation year.

Profession

State your current job designation, the organization you work for, and the city you are currently employed in. Including an approximate annual salary is optional but often highly appreciated by families.

Partner Preferences

Be clear about what you are seeking in a life partner to ensure you attract the right profiles.

Partner Expectations

Describe your ideal partner's age range, expected educational background, and professional status (whether you prefer someone working or not). More importantly, mention if you require a partner from the exact same denomination or if you are open to other Christian backgrounds.

Frequently Asked Questions

Do I need a letter from my Parish Priest?

You don't need to include a letter from your priest in the biodata itself. However, for Catholic and Orthodox marriages, you will eventually need a 'Free State Certificate' or letter from your parish during the formal church marriage preparation process.

Should I include my Baptism details?

While not strictly mandatory on a standard biodata, mentioning your Baptism date and location is highly appreciated in traditional families, as it serves as proof of your faith and standing in the church.
